Musculoskeletal disorders (MSDs) can be characterized from their occupational etiology and their occurrence; their chronicity generates negative repercussions for the health of workers, especially of artisanal fishing. To investigate the prevalence of generalized musculoskeletal disorders by body region and self-reported pain in a fishing population of northeastern Brazil, an epidemiological cross-sectional study was carried out in Santiago do Iguape, Bahia-Brazil, in 2017. The Brazilian version of the Nordic Musculoskeletal Questionnaire (NMQ), in addition to a questionnaire containing the socio-demographic and labor conditions were applied to a random stratified sample of 248 artisanal fisheries. There were 170 female shellfish gatherers and 78 fishermen, with a mean age of 36.7 years (SD = 10.5 years) and 43.3 years (SD = 11.8 years), respectively. The beginning of the labor activity was initiated at approximately 11 years of age. The average weekly income varied from 17.64 USD to 29.10 USD. The prevalence of MSD independent of occupation occurred in at least one body region in 93.5% and the presence of musculoskeletal pain/discomfort over the last seven days in 95.2% of the fishing workers. The highest prevalence of MSD was found in shellfish gatherers in: lower back (86.4%), wrist and hand (73.5%), and upper back (66.8%). In relation to the presence of pain in the last year, the frequency of pain was greater in the fishermen compared to the shellfish gatherers. The generalized severity of the MSD in 93.5% of this community of fishermen is evident, with emphasis in the following regions: lower back, wrist and hand and upper back in both groups, with occurrence of pain in more than one body region at the same time.

ABSTRACT Objective: to analyze factors associated with presenteeism in nursing workers with sociodemographic variables, health and work conditions, productivity and musculoskeletal symptoms. Methods: this is a cross-sectional, descriptive and analytical study, with 306 nursing workers from a hospital and municipal emergency room in a Brazilian capital. The Stanford Presenteeism Scale, the Work Limitations Questionnaire, the Nordic Musculoskeletal Questionnaire and a demographic questionnaire on nursing professionals’ working conditions and health were used. Bivariate and multivariate analyzes were performed, respecting a significance level of 5%. Results: presenteeism was found in 43.8% of professionals and significant associations with CLT work (p=0.002), workplace - Intensive Care Units (p=0.008), physical exercise twice a week (p=0.008), presence of musculoskeletal symptoms, with low back pain being representative (p=0.001). The productivity loss was 8.8. Conclusions: the study confirms a high rate of presenteeism among nursing workers.

BACKGROUND: The presence of low back pain in nurses is becoming increasingly prominent and it has significant impact both on the individual as well as on the community. OBJECTIVE: The aim of this study was to determine the prevalence of low back pain among practicing nurses. METHODS: The research has been conducted in five health care institutions in the area of Vojvodina. Data were collected using the Nordic Musculoskeletal Questionnaire (NMQ). RESULTS: Five hundred and twelve nurses participated in this study. Most of the participants (93.95%) indicated that they experienced discomfort or pain in the lower back in the last 12 months. Due to low back pain, 61.95% of participants had reduced working abilities and 76.09% of participants have never taken time off from work. CONCLUSIONS: Due to low back pain nurses have a reduced working capacity, but they nevertheless rarely seek medical help or the change of the work place. The implementation of better ergonomic approach and adequate organization of work could reduce the occurrence of low back pain.

The purpose of this study was to identify the prevalence of musculoskeletal problems in bio-pharmaceutical industry workers. A cross sectional survey was conducted on 33 bio-pharmaceutical industry workers by administering the Extended Nordic Musculoskeletal Questionnaire to quantify the musculoskeletal pain and activity limitation in 9 body regions. The Rapid Office Strain Assessment was used to assess the work-related postures and ergonomics of the computer operators in this industry. A Self-Designed Questionnaire was administered to obtain data regarding the various musculoskeletal problems faced by Bio-pharmaceutical industrial workers, work-related risk factors and various postures attained throughout the day. Out of the 33 workers investigated, 21 workers (63%) of the workers experienced musculoskeletal pain. Isolated spine pain was the commonest, and was reported in 8 out of 21 individuals (38%). Spine with upper and lower limb pain was the next most common, and was reported in 5 out of 21 individuals (24%). 4 out of 21 individuals had spine and lower limb pain (19%). The Rapid Office Strain Assessment scores of all the workers was above 5 indicating “high risk” which implied that immediate ergonomic change was necessary. This study concluded that there was 63% prevalence of musculoskeletal pain. The most common site of pain were the spine, followed by pain in the spine with both upper and lower extremities. All the workers were exposed to different ergonomic risk factors. The study concluded that implementation of ergonomic interventions may minimize the risks of work related musculoskeletal pain. Background: The objectives were to evaluate the frequency of musculoskeletal symptoms related to screen time and to determine the mostly affected body parts with musculoskeletal symptoms Methods: A Cross-sectional survey was conducted on 150 students from February to May 2018 selected via convenience sampling technique. Data was collected from students of twin cities having screen time more than 3 hour’s using validated questionnaires including The Nordic Musculoskeletal Questionnaire (NMQ) to assess musculoskeletal symptoms and self-structured questionnaire for screen time and demographics. Data was analyzed using SPSS v.21. Results: Mean age of the population was 15±2.7 years. Mean screen time score was computed as 6.45 hours with 10 hours highest screen time observed of 6 participants. Mean musculoskeletal involvement was computed as 85.3 % (n=128) in last 12 months of which 28.9% (n=66) had neck pain, 21.9% (n=50) had lower back pain whereas 14.9%, 11.4% had shoulder and upper back involvement. In last 7 days 25.7%, participants had pain in neck area and 18.3% in lower back. 83.5% participants didn’t visited physicians for their respective condition. significant relation of screen time was observed with the musculoskeletal symptoms. Conclusion: Screen time severely influence musculoskeletal symptoms especially neck and lower back muscle, presence of high number of musculoskeletal symptoms among adolescent is alarming and shows the need of adequate measures to address these problems

Aim: This study was conducted to determine the prevalence of musculoskeletal pain disorders and related factors among female school teachers of Peshawar. Methodology: A descriptive cross-sectional survey was conducted from February 2019 to July 2019 among primary and secondary female school teachers (n=289) in Peshawar. Data was collected from using semi-structured questionnaire. Outcome measures were based on modified version of Nordic musculoskeletal questionnaire (NMQ) and Numeric Pain Rating Scale (NPRS). Descriptive statistics was used to summarize qualitative variables in the form of frequencies and percentages. Mean and standard deviation was calculated for quantitative variables. Chi-square test was used to find association. The significant P value was <0.05. Results: Prevalence of musculoskeletal pain disorders was 82.7%. The overall mean age of sample was 37.5±8.47. Most common sites of pain were low back 60.2% followed by neck pain 50.2%, ankle pain 48.4% and shoulder pain 44.3%. Factors that showed significant relationship were long time standing (p=0.001), long time sitting (p=0.039), checking copy/paper marking (p value 0.023) and uncomfortable work chair/table (p = 0.012). Conclusion: Female school teachers showed high prevalence of musculoskeletal pain disorders, low back was the most common site for pain followed by ankle and shoulder. Risk factors associated with pain were long time standing, long time sitting, checking copy/paper marking and uncomfortable work chair/table. Background: The Nagpur Metro rail project workers are involved in heavy activities like pulling, pushing, lifting heavy loads and other heavy tasks. This makes them susceptible to Musculoskeletal disorders (MSDs)/symptoms. Aim and objectives: To find out the presence of work related musculoskeletal symptoms in Metro workers in Nagpur city using Nordic musculoskeletal questionnaire. Methods: 120 workers falling, in the age range of 20 to 45 years and involved in labor work were included using the convenient sampling method. Samples were excluded if they have recent fractures or surgery, any neurological conditions or who were not willing to participate. Nordic Musculoskeletal questionnaire was explained to each and every worker in their vernacular language. Results and Conclusion: The result showed that there is multiple region involvement among the subjects. The most affected region was found to be upper back followed by low back, knee, shoulder, neck. A wide range of inflammatory and degenerative conditions affecting muscles, tendons, joints, peripheral nerves, are categorized as “musculoskeletal disorders” (MSDs). Exposure to vibration and noises, the varying climatic conditions and the standing posture needs to be considered as a stress factor contributing to his/her health status. As conductors do constant work for 5 to 6 hours with 1-2 breaks in between while working they are constantly exposed to vibrational forces. : To assess the musculoskeletal problems in bus conductors of Nagpur city.: To assess the musculoskeletal problems in bus conductors in last one year (based on site of musculoskeletal problem using Nordic musculoskeletal questionnaire). : It was an observational study conducted on 100 bus conductors between age group of 20-50 years working with Nagpur Mahanagar Parivahan Limited (NMPL-AAPLI BUS). Nordic musculoskeletal questionnaire was used to assess musculoskeletal pain at various regions of body. : The most commonly affected area was knee joint (37%) followed by lower back (17%) and ankles/feet (11%).

Background: People nowadays have developed a new passion of weightlifting. Weightlifting focuses on vigorous muscle development. But injuries are also common in weightlifting. This study aims to compare the injury rates among supervised and non-supervised weightlifters. Methods: A group of 138 weight lifters was divided into two groups i.e. who did training under supervision and the other who did training without any supervision. Injuries related to musculoskeletal system were identified using Nordic musculoskeletal questionnaire. Data was analyzed using SPSS. Chi square test was used to see the association of musculoskeletal pain among weightlifters with or without supervision. Results: Significant association found between musculoskeletal injuries and supervision. Injuries lesser in number among supervised weightlifters as compared to unsupervised weightlifters. Mean age of weight lifters under supervision and without supervision was 21.99 (SD 3.81) and 24.64 (SD 5.01) respectively. Mean workout days /week among weight lifters under supervision was almost same i.e. 5.67 (SD .63) and was 5.62 (SD .81). Out of 51 participants who work-out for 46-60 min, 30 were not under supervision while 31 weightlifters who work-out for 61-90 min were working out under supervision. Injury rate was more in the region of shoulder in both groups supervised and unsupervised groups while hip/thigh region was less involved in both supervised and unsupervised groups. Conclusion: Overall results showed significant association between musculoskeletal injuries and supervision. Injury rate was more among weightlifters who work without supervision as compared to those who work under supervision. Care should be taken and weight lifting and exercises must be performed under expert’s supervision.
